public void mapToJson(){
Map<String, Object> map = new HashMap<String, Object>();
map.put("name", "张三");
map.put("age", "12");
map.put("address", "山东");
JSONObject jsonObject = JSONObject.fromObject(map);
System.out.println(jsonObject);
}
输出结果为:{"address":"山东","age":"12","name":"张三"}
需要jar包:json-lib-2.3-jdk15.jar
相关推荐
全国世界地图map-json是一个基于Echarts数据可视化库的项目,主要目标是利用json格式的数据来绘制全球或中国各个城市的地图。Echarts是一个轻量级、高性能的JavaScript图表库,广泛应用于数据分析、信息展示等领域。...
echarts 地图json
2. JSON数据 J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。在ECharts地图中,JSON数据文件包含了地图的几何形状、属性信息等,如省份、城市的名字...
在标题 "echarts-mapJson-中国各省市县区地图json包" 中提到的 "地图json包" 是 ECharts 实现中国地图可视化时所需的数据资源。 地图json文件是 ECharts 显示地理区域数据的关键,它包含了中国各个省市县区的边界...
本压缩包提供了两个关键功能:将Map对象转换为JSON字符串和将List对象转换为JSON字符串。这两个工具类对于Android开发者来说非常实用,因为它们简化了Java对象与JSON格式之间的互换过程。 首先,让我们详细了解Map...
在这个场景中,我们关注的是"Map转JSON"和"mapתJSON"这两个文件名,它们可能指的是包含这些转换功能的jar包。通常,这些库的jar包会包含一系列类和方法,用于将Java对象(如Map)转换为JSON字符串,反之亦然。 1. ...
2. **JSON序列化有序map**: - `encoding/json`库不支持直接序列化有序map,我们需要自定义`MarshalJSON`方法来实现有序序列化。在该方法中,我们可以遍历有序map,按照key的顺序生成JSON格式的字符串。 ```go ...
"java转换xml、list、map和json" 本文主要讲述了Java中将xml、list、map和json之间的转换的相关知识点。 xml和map之间的转换 在Java中,xml和map之间的转换可以通过使用dom4j库来实现。dom4j是一个Java开源库,...
本篇文章将深入探讨如何将Java中的List和Map对象转化为JSON格式,并涉及与AJAX交互的相关知识。 1. **Java JSON库**: 在Java中,我们可以使用多种库来实现对象到JSON的转换,如Jackson、Gson、Fastjson等。这里以...
Map, Object> map = gson.fromJson(jsonString, Map.class); ``` 转换成List则需要指定List元素类型: ```java import com.google.gson.Gson; import java.util.List; String jsonString = "[{\"key\":\...
map转json所需jar集合,map转json出现异常,原因是少了JAR包,造成类找不到,除了要导入JSON网站上面下载的json-lib-2.1.jar包之外,还必须有其它几个依赖包: commons-beanutils.jar,commons-httpclient.jar,...
2. 然后,使用`ObjectMapper`类将Map转换为Json字符串: ```java ObjectMapper mapper = new ObjectMapper(); String json = mapper.writeValueAsString(myMap); System.out.println(json); ``` 对于其他编程...
2. **配置地图系列**:在 ECharts 实例的配置项中,添加地图系列(series),并指定地图类型和对应的 `mapJson` 名称: ```javascript var option = { series: [{ type: 'map', mapType: 'yourMapName', // ...
这些地图通常以 JavaScript 对象(JSON)格式存储,包含了地理坐标信息,可以与 ECharts 的地图系列(series-type: 'map')配合使用,将数据绑定到地图上,形成具有交互性的地图图表。 1. **ECharts 地图数据格式**...
- `map2json(Map, ?> map)`:用于处理`Map`类型的对象。 - `set2json(Set<?> set)`:用于处理`Set`类型的对象。 #### 三、转换逻辑详解 1. **基础类型处理**: - 当输入的对象为基本数据类型如`String`、`Integer...
在示例`Map2Json.java`中,我们创建了一个HashMap对象并填充了一些键值对。然后使用`JSONArray.fromObject(map)`方法将Map对象转换为JSONArray。这个JSONArray是一个JSON数组,其中每个元素都是一个JSON对象,对应于...
2. **获取JSON字符串**:假设我们已经有了一个JSON字符串,例如: ```json { "name": "John", "age": 30, "city": "New York" } ``` 3. **调用fromJson()方法**:使用`Gson`对象的`fromJson()`方法,将JSON字符串...
2. JSON到JavaBean的转换: 同样,我们也可以将JSON字符串转换为JavaBean对象。首先,你需要定义一个与JSON结构对应的JavaBean类,然后使用Jackson的`ObjectMapper`进行转换: ```java public class User { ...
"河南省18个地市的行政区化图mapJSON数据"这个标题指出,我们有一个数据资源,它是关于中国河南省的地图信息,具体形式是MapJSON格式。MapJSON是一种常见的地理信息数据结构,主要用于描绘地理区域的边界、属性等...
本教程将深入讲解如何使用Java读取JSON文件,并将其内容转化为Map以便进行取值操作。 首先,我们需要引入处理JSON的库。Java标准库并不直接支持JSON操作,所以我们通常会使用第三方库,如`org.json`或`...